The kinetic energy of falling water can be harnessed to generate electricity through hydropower plants. The potential energy of the water is converted into kinetic energy as it falls, which in turn drives turbines connected to generators, producing electricity. This renewable energy source is clean, sustainable, and widely used around the world.

Flowing or falling water can be harnessed to turn a waterwheel or spin a turbine, either of which can be connected to a generator. The kinetic energy of water (imparted by gravity) is converted into electric power by that generator.
The hydroelectricity is produced by using the kinetic energy of falling water to drive turbines thus producing mechanical energy which is in turn converted to electrical energy.Dams are built across rivers for this.
